Ok as a rehab tool, but not for a proper forearm workout
If you have very weak wrists or any sort of injury or pain in them I think this is a great tool to help strengthen them. To build proper strength though there is simply not enough resistance. You do get somewhat of a pump after a while, but I found the pain from the device digging into my arm muscles was more painful than the pump itself.

Will work the muscles, but lacks enough tension
I have had this product for a few days, so I cannot comment on the durability. I will revise the review if anything goes wrong with it.I wasn't sure what to expect from this exerciser. Forearms are notoriously difficult to isolate, and I have tried various exercises in the past, from wrist curls with weights, to wrist rollers. There's always something that doesn't quite work.In the case of this exerciser, I selected the more difficult tension, as I am reasonably athletic although my forearm strength isn't amazing. I could do 15+ reps the very first time I used the equipment, on both overarm and underarm curls, also using my weaker arm, so it wasn't really providing a challenge.In terms of the movement, it is good. It retains tension throughout, and is enough to make the forearms feel like they are doing some work, but I would have liked a lot more tension. I still think it's useful, just to work the muscles a bit, but only to strengthen weaknesses and maybe add a bit of wrist stability.
